What's included in EV roadside assistance in Los Alamitos?

  • Coverage across 45 cities and communities in Orange County
  • Mobile Level 2 charging (240V / 9.6 kW) brought to your location
  • Tesla 12V jump-start for dead accessory batteries
  • CCS adapter support for Rivian, Ford, Hyundai, Kia, Polestar, Bolt
  • Charge port troubleshooting when the handle won't latch or release
  • PIN-to-drive and valet lockout coordination with Tesla support
  • Tow dispatch coordination if on-site charge won't resolve the problem
  • Freeway shoulder safety setup, cones, vest, flares if needed

Why not just call AAA?

AAA will tow your EV, they generally won't charge it. Some AAA regions now partner with mobile charging companies in major metros, but coverage varies. If you want the car charged on site instead of loaded onto a flatbed, call us first. Ask the operator directly about AAA reimbursement, since policies differ.
